Yes. FabMo uses gun:0/1 to set default units as well as the g20/21 which is run at the beginning of a file to specify the unit for the file.
With respect to 'gun', FabMo-G2core operates differently than G2core. That's because we needed/wanted a system for setting a default and persistent Unit mode independently of running a gcode file. I believe this is basically accomplished in: canonical_machine.cpp Lines: 2516 - 2525

The primary/basic unit conversion from inches to mm or mm to inches no longer updates the current position {pos: } after the unit change made with {gun: }.
This functionality worked correctly through version 101.57.32. It was broken with commit 4d149970 "main item 34 faulty sr from feedhold or kill" 1/28/22 and remains broken through 101.57.35.
Sample after break (edited for readibility): g2: --S-1647109441151----> {gun:n} [g2] g2: <-S-1647109441158----- {"r":{"gun":0},"f":[1,0,9]} [g2] g2: --S-1647109392429----> {mpo:n} [g2] g2: <-S-1647109392440----- {"r":{"mpo":{"x":54.86393,"y":27.43183,"z":0,"a":0,"b":0,"c":0}},"f":[1,0,9]} [g2] g2: --S-1647109418224----> {pos:n} [g2] g2: <-S-1647109418235----- {"r":{"pos":{"x":2.16,"y":1.07999,"z":0,"a":0,"b":0,"c":0}},"f":[1,0,9]} [g2] g2: --S-1647109452416----> {gun:1} [g2] g2: <-S-1647109452423----- {"r":{"gun":1},"f":[1,0,9]} [g2] g2: --S-1647109465315----> {mpo:n} [g2] g2: <-S-1647109465325----- {"r":{"mpo":{"x":54.86393,"y":27.43183,"z":0,"a":0,"b":0,"c":0}},"f":[1,0,9]} [g2] g2: --S-1647109472507----> {pos:n} [g2] g2: <-S-1647109472520----- {"r":{"pos":{"x":2.16,"y":1.07999,"z":0,"a":0,"b":0,"c":0}},"f":[1,0,9]} [g2] => tool is now in metric and these values should reflect the change rather than just duplicating the inch values
